Levi's
[ lee-vahyz ]
/ ˈli vaɪz /
Save This Word!
(used with a plural verb)Trademark.
a brand of clothing, especially blue jeans.

Lévis
[ lee-vis; French ley-vee ]
/ ˈli vɪs; French leɪˈvi /
noun
a city in S Quebec, in E Canada, across from Montreal, on the St. Lawrence.
